Suvendu Adhikari takes oath as BJP's first-ever West Bengal Chief Minister
West Bengal | May 09, 2026 23:53 ISTSuvendu Adhikari took oath as the Chief Minister of West Bengal at a grand ceremony held at Kolkata’s Brigade Parade Ground at 11 am on Saturday. The BJP, which won 207 seats in the assembly elections, formed its first government in the state after a major political shift.

Bengal Election Result: BJP bounces back from 2024 setback, leads in 29 Lok Sabha seats | Full list
West Bengal | May 11, 2026 19:05 ISTBaharampur emerged as one of the biggest surprises, with the BJP taking a lead of 86,187 votes over the TMC. The party secured a total of 5,12,273 votes across the constituency’s seven Assembly segments - Burwan, Kandi, Bharatpur, Rejinagar, Beldanga, Baharampur, and Naoda.

Suvendu Adhikari PA murder: SIT formed, IG-rank officer to lead probe in West Bengal
West Bengal | May 07, 2026 23:55 ISTSuvendu Adhikari's PA Chandranath Rath was shot dead on Wednesday night in North 24 Parganas which has escalated political tensions in West Bengal ahead of the new government's swearing-in. The state police have formed an SIT led by an IG-rank officer to investigate the murder.
